Notes on "Short-Eared Owl Icon (Reprise)": based on a special painting commissioned by a NYC collector, therefore all creatures are indigenous, endangered/rare species in NY State (Short-Eared Owl, Piping Plover, Peregrine Falcon [ Peregrine is on the rebound as a 'resurrection story' ], etc... not to mention NY State landmarks such as Manhattan Bridge + Montauk Lighthouse, plus a rat tail cameo in rocks, which the Peregrines prey upon in the City)
